Configure OIDC/LDAP Authentication for Kubernetes User Authentication
After installing , you should configure / authentication for kubernetes access user authentication.
/ authentication can be supported by 's local server and/or up to three remote servers (for example, Windows Active Directory).
In this example, / authentication is setup for local .
- You must have the credentials for the 'sysadmin' local Linux user account used for installation.
Login to the active controller as the 'sysadmin' user.
Use either a local console or .
Setup 'sysadmin' credentials.
